Here's a little hint I got from playing VV2, if you get a mushroom, put your game on pause and then put all the children you have on the mushroom. They will all pick the mushroom so you will get double, triple etc food depending how how many children you get on in time, as it dissappears fairly fast. In VV2, I've found that you need to pile three kids onto a mushroom or collectable and you'll get two mushrooms or collectables. It's kind of strange, but if you put only two children on it, you'll still only get one. In short, in VV2, you need to follow this formula: The number of mushrooms or collectables is equal to the number of children minus one.  (NOTE: This doesn't apply to a collectable if it is uncommon or rare and hasn't been found before.)

The two oldest will always walk away with nothing when you are piling them all on one mushroom. I like to think that they are teaching the younger ones. - that is for VV2 though.
In VV1, all children will pick one up. If you put two on the mushie, you get two mushies.

VV1:
When my villagers got low on food, and wouldn't always plant new crops on their own (they were tending to run out of food and started starving themselves when I "quit" the game), I finally made the decision to buy the third level of farming tech (I'd been trying to hold out, because I wanted the third level of construction instead). This taught them to fish, and gave them an infinite food supply. Now when I quit the game, I don't have to worry about them running low on food, because they automatically fish, and even plant and harvest crops. This also seems to help the scientists continue their research, because they're not pacing back and forth, "worrying about food".
